Disney World: Day 5 Recap

Rest days are a necessity for any Disney vacation, no matter the length of your trip. 😉 We have been pushing it and hoofing it all over Disney World, so we were overdue! Our plans today included a character breakfast with Minnie and her friends, spending time at the pool, and a character dinner at 1900 Park Fare.  Both boys slept in until 7:00 which was amazing! We got dressed and ready and began our way towards Cape May Cafe located at The Beach Club Resort. We took the Skyliner from our resort to the International Gateway at Epcot. From there, we had about a 5 minute walk to our restaurant. Super easy!  This character meal is one of the lesser known options for character dining. We've done character dining at Topolino's Terrace (amazing!), Tusker House and Chef Mickey's, so we were excited to try something different.
